Why These Are the Top Kia Repair Auto Repair Shops in Marianna

** The Kia repair market for residents of Marianna, PA, is characterized by a need to travel to nearby population centers for specialized service. The local market within Marianna offers only general automotive repair, which is unsuitable for the complex, warranty-bound, and technology-specific needs of modern Kia vehicles (especially concerning Theta engines, DCTs, and EVs). The competitive landscape is thus defined by two primary dealerships—**Kia of Washington** and **Day Kia**—which dominate the market for warranty work, recall service, and factory-backed technical expertise. A reputable independent shop like **Chapman Auto Repair** provides a viable, often more cost-effective, alternative for non-warranty specialized repairs, particularly for high-mileage GDI engines and transmission issues. **Typical Pricing:** Dealership labor rates in this region are typically between $130-$160 per hour. Independent specialists are generally 15-25% less. For reference, a standard Theta engine inspection under a recall campaign would have no cost to the customer, while an out-of-warranty engine carbon cleaning service could range from $400-$700.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about kia repair services in Marianna, PA

Where in the Marianna area can I find a repair shop that specializes in Kia vehicles?

While Marianna itself is a small borough, residents typically look to nearby Washington or Canonsburg for specialized Kia service. It's recommended to seek a shop that is Kia-certified or has technicians with specific Kia training and diagnostic tools, which you can find at select dealerships and independent shops in those surrounding communities.

What are the most common Kia repair issues for drivers in the Marianna, PA, region?

Given our hilly terrain and use of road salt in winter, common local issues include premature brake wear and corrosion on components like brake lines and exhaust systems. Some Kia models may also require attention for engine-related recalls or electrical issues, which a local shop familiar with these patterns can efficiently diagnose.

How do local driving conditions around Marianna affect when I should seek Kia service?

The steep, winding roads and seasonal potholes can accelerate wear on suspension components, tires, and alignment. It's advisable to have your Kia's suspension and steering checked more frequently than the manual suggests, especially after winter, and to address any unusual noises or pulling immediately.

Are Kia repair costs higher at dealerships versus independent shops in the Washington County area?

Generally, labor rates at dealerships in Washington or Canonsburg are higher than at independent shops. However, for complex computer or warranty-related repairs, a dealership may have the latest OEM parts and specific software. For routine maintenance and many repairs, a reputable local independent mechanic can offer quality service at a more competitive price.

What should I look for to ensure a quality Kia repair experience with a local mechanic?

Look for an ASE-certified technician with proven experience working on Kias, and ask for references from other local customers. A reputable shop in the area should be transparent about estimates, willing to show you old parts, and use quality parts, understanding the demands of local driving on your vehicle.
